    The last British Emperor of India was

    King George I

    Incorrect Answer

    King George III

    Incorrect Answer

    King George V

    Incorrect Answer

    King George VI

    Correct Answer
    Explanation:

    George VI continued to hold the title King of India for two years during the short Governor-Generalships of Lord Mountbatten and of C. Rajagopalachari until India became a republic on 26 January 1950. George VI remained as King of the United Kingdom and King of Pakistan until his death in 1952.
